- Country: England
- State: South West
- City: Gloucester
- Address: 27 Peregrine Cl, Quedgeley, Gloucester GL2 4LG, UK
- Store
More companies in your city
Bourne to Plumb LTD Plumbing & Heating Engineers
92 Wheatway, Abbeydale, Gloucester GL4 4BJ, UK
- 5 reviews
Added comment